Southern Asia: Market for Process Control, Gate, Globe and Other Valves 2025

Market Size for Process Control, Gate, Globe and Other Valves in Southern Asia

For the eleventh year in a row, the South Asian market for process control, gate, globe and other valves recorded growth in sales value, which increased by 0.6% to $X in 2022. The total consumption indicated a resilient expansion from 2012 to 2022: its value increased at an average annual rate of +5.1% over the last decade.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2022 figures, consumption increased by +65.1% against 2012 indices. Over the period under review, the market hit record highs in 2022 and is likely to see steady growth in years to come.

Imports by Country

In 2022, India (X tons) was the main importer of process control, gate, globe and other valves, making up 74% of total imports. It was distantly followed by Bangladesh (X tons), achieving a 14% share of total imports. Sri Lanka (X tons), Nepal (X tons) and Pakistan (X tons) followed a long way behind the leaders.

Imports into India increased at an average annual rate of +5.5% from 2012 to 2022. At the same time, Nepal (+26.8%), Bangladesh (+15.2%) and Sri Lanka (+2.0%) displayed positive paces of growth. Moreover, Nepal emerged as the fastest-growing importer imported in Southern Asia, with a CAGR of +26.8% from 2012-2022. Pakistan experienced a relatively flat trend pattern. Bangladesh (+7.9 p.p.) and Nepal (+2.5 p.p.) significantly strengthened its position in terms of the total imports, while Sri Lanka, Pakistan and India saw its share reduced by -2.1%, -2.8% and -5.1% from 2012 to 2022, respectively.

In value terms, India ($X) constitutes the largest market for imported process control, gate, globe and other valves in Southern Asia, comprising 81% of total imports. The second position in the ranking was held by Bangladesh ($X), with a 9.5% share of total imports. It was followed by Pakistan, with a 4.6% share.

In India, imports of process control, gate, globe and other valves increased at an average annual rate of +4.1% over the period from 2012-2022. In the other countries, the average annual rates were as follows: Bangladesh (+17.5% per year) and Pakistan (+1.5% per year).
